Oil Weight - 945t 900

I changed the oil in my '93 945t over the weekend using Mobil 1 5w30. I had been running 10w30 through the summer and figured the majority of the heat had passed in Detroit. When I logged the change in the service book, I noted that Volvo is recommending 10w30 for temperatures above 68. It will likely be below 80, but certainly above 68 for much of September. Am I paranoid to be concerned? The car has 95,000 miles, and wasn't leaking with 10w30 synthetic, so I figured 5w30 might offer better cold weather performance and slightly better mpg. Any comments?
